The ratio of average velocity of a gas molecule to the root mean square velocity at a particular temperature is

  1. A 1 : 1.81
  2. B 1.81 : 1
  3. C 2 : 1.81
  4. D 1.81 : 2
Verified Solution

Answer & Solution

Correct Answer

(A) 1 : 1.81

Step-by-step Solution

Detailed explanation

The expression for root mean square velocity is \(\left(\mu_{\mathrm{rms}}\right)=\sqrt{\frac{3 R T}{M}},\) and for average speed, \(\left(\mu_{\text {avg }}\right)=\sqrt{\frac{8 R T}{\pi M}}\) For a particular gas, at particular temperature \(M\) and \(T\) are constant.…
